Attachment-Based Therapy focuses on how early connections shape current relationships and emotions. Sessions look at patterns of trust and closeness and help people try new ways of relating when old patterns cause pain.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, or CBT, helps people identify and change unhelpful thoughts and behaviors. It is useful for anxiety, depression, panic attacks, and mood problems through clear exercises and homework between sessions. Mindfulness Therapy teaches simple awareness practices to reduce reactivity and increase present-moment control; it can help with stress, rumination, and emotional regulation.Finding the right approach is part of the work. Online formats include video calls, phone sessions, live chat, and text-based messaging. Video is helpful for in-depth conversation and visual cues. Phone sessions can fit a shorter check-in or work when bandwidth is limited. Live chat and text messaging offer flexibility for brief reflections or ongoing support between scheduled meetings. These options make it easier to fit therapy around work, caregiving, or travel while maintaining steady progress.
